Compton scattering from positronium and validity of the impulse approximation
The cross sections for Compton scattering from positronium are calculated in the range from 1 to 100~keV of incident photon energy. The calculations are based on the $\aA$ term of the photon--electron/positron interaction. Unlike in hydrogen, the scattering occurs from two centers and the interference effect plays an important role for energies below 8~keV. Because of the interference the criterion for validity of the impulse approximation for positronium is more restrictive compared to that for hydrogen
